Several horses have been confirmed to have died of it in NY.  There has
been
at least one in Rhode Island.  In CT they have found dead birds testing
positive for the disease in over 5 towns.  The quick spread is being
attibuted to the migration of birds.  We are being told to send any birds
found dead to a government testing lab...who happens to be so back logged
that it takes a month to get the results.
